How to Make Lucky Charms Treats

Step 1: Prepare Your Pan

Line a 9×9-inch baking pan with parchment paper or foil. This will make it easier to remove and cut your treats later.

Step 2: Sort Your Cereal

Measure out the Lucky Charms and set aside about ⅓ cup of the colorful marshmallow pieces. These will be used as a topping later.

Step 3: Melt the Marshmallows

In a large pot,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the mini marshmallows and stir until they’re completely melted and smooth.

Step 4: Mix in the Cereal

Remove the pot from heat and quickly fold in the Lucky Charms cereal. The key here is to work fast before the marshmallows start to cool.

Step 5: Press and Top

Pour the mixture into your prepared pan and press it down evenly. Sprinkle those reserved marshmallows on top and gently press them in.

Step 6: Cool and Cut

Let the treats cool completely, then lift them out of the pan using the parchment paper. Cut into squares and enjoy!

Pro Tips for Making the Recipe

  • Don’t overheat the marshmallows – they can become tough if cooked too long.
  • Use a buttered spatula or wax paper to press the mixture into the pan to prevent sticking.
  • For extra gooey treats, reduce the amount of cereal slightly.
  • Let the treats cool completely before cutting for clean, neat squares.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Store in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days. Place wax paper between layers to prevent sticking.

Freezing

These treats freeze well! Wrap individually in plastic wrap and store in a freezer bag for up to 6 weeks.

Reheating

No need to reheat – just let frozen treats thaw at room temperature for about 30 minutes before enjoying.

FAQs

Can I use regular marshmallows instead of mini?
Absolutely! Just chop them into smaller pieces for easier melting.

My treats turned out too hard. What went wrong?
You might have cooked the marshmallows too long or pressed the mixture too firmly into the pan. Remember to work quickly and press gently.

Can I make these in a microwave instead of on the stovetop?
Yes! Microwave the butter and marshmallows in 30-second intervals, stirring between each, until melted. Then follow the rest of the recipe as written.

How can I make these treats less sweet?
Try reducing the amount of marshmallows slightly or adding a pinch of salt to balance the sweetness.

Ingredients

Units Scale
  • 7 cups Lucky Charms cereal (10 ounces, 275g)
  • 5 tablespoons unsalted butter (70g)
  • 7 cups mini marshmallows (12 ounces, 340g)

Instructions

  1. Prepare the Pan: Line a 9×9-inch baking pan with parchment paper or foil. You can spray the pan first with nonstick cooking spray to hold the lining in place, if needed.
  2. Prepare the Cereal: Measure out the cereal, then remove about ⅓ cup of the colorful marshmallow pieces. Set these aside for later use as a topping.
  3. Melt the Marshmallows: In a large pot,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the marshmallows and stir frequently with a silicone spatula until fully melted, which should take about 5 to 7 minutes. Remove the pot from the heat once melted.
  4. Combine Cereal and Marshmallow: Immediately add the cereal to the melted marshmallow mixture and fold to combine. It’s crucial to work quickly at this stage, as the marshmallows in the cereal will begin to melt.
  5. Form the Treats: Pour the mixture into the prepared baking pan. Using the silicone spatula or the butter stick wrapper, press the mixture into an even layer in the pan. Sprinkle the reserved marshmallows over the top and gently press them into the surface.
  6. Cool and Cut: Let the treats cool completely, which takes about 1 hour. Once cooled, use the parchment to remove the treats from the pan. Lightly grease a sharp knife and cut the treats into squares.

Notes

  • Add a pinch of salt to the marshmallow and butter mixture to help balance the sweet flavors.
  • For an extra touch, sprinkle the top of the bars with flaky sea salt.
  • Work quickly when combining the cereal with the melted marshmallows to prevent the cereal marshmallows from dissolving.
  • Spray your spatula with cooking spray when pressing the mixture into the pan to prevent sticking.
  • Avoid packing the mixture too tightly in the pan, as this can make the bars hard and dense.
  • For easy cleanup, soak the pot in hot water with dish soap to dissolve any sticky marshmallow residue.
